yes they went out of business, however The owner now works @ National Speed in NC... So he is there to anwser any questions and George has been more then helpful with me.

As for Service... nil, its a turbo, if and when you need a rebuild, you just buy a new CHRA and your done, or you can get it rebuilt by any reputable turbo rebuilder, its a garret, so It wont be a problem.
